Bradford Game Causing Problems For Some City Supporters.

A number of Coventry City supporters have been affected by Sky Sports decision to move the Sky Blues League One game to Sunday November 17th.

A number of our southern based support including supporters from Kent, Cambridgeshire and London had all bought advance train tickets for the game at Valley Parade, expecting it to be played on the Saturday but now have told us that their tickets are useless as the match takes place twenty four and a half hours later after the match was moved on Thursday. 

Again, we back the calls of the Football Supporters Federation for television companies like Sky Sports and now BT Sports to be ordered to give a minimum of three months notice when switching the day of a game.
